新项目创建

1、react + antd + ts

yarn create react-app xxx --template typescript

安装antd

yarn add antd

2、react + ts

yarn create-react-app xxx --template typescript

已有react项目

1、安装ts

npm i typescript -g 全局安装
npm i typescript -D 当前项目安装

2、tsc --init

修改tsconfig配置文件

{"compilerOptions": {"target": "es5", /**指定ECMAScript目标版本**/                   "module": "commonjs", /**指定生成哪个模块系统代码**/ "allowJs": true,  /**允许编译js文件**/                     "jsx": "preserve",  /**支持JSX**/                  "outDir": "build",  /**编译输出目录**/    "strict": true, /**启用所有严格类型检查选项**/ "noImplicitAny": false, /**在表达式和声明上有隐含的any类型时报错**/          "skipLibCheck": true,  /**忽略所有的声明文件的类型检查**/                   "forceConsistentCasingInFileNames": true   /**禁止对同一个文件的不一致的引用**/   },"include": ["src"] /**指定编译目录**/
}

3、安装依赖(npm —S)

yarn add typescript
yarn add @types/react @types/react-dom

react项目添加ts相关推荐

  1. 搭建react项目 搭建ts react项目 使用vite搭建react项目

    创建react 项目 注意: 网上有一些生成react 的方法,但是也有一些是过时的. 使用官方脚手架creact-react-app 全局安装 creact-react-app 这个脚手架 这个脚手 ...

  2. react 项目添加百度统计

    将如下代码添加到 index.html 的 </body> 标签前 <body><div id="root"></div><! ...

  3. react 使用 leaflet 百度地图_【React】react项目中应用百度地图添加起始点绘制路线...

    如图:项目中百度地图的应用添加起始点.终点并绘制路线 在展示代码的时候首先展示一下后台返回给我的接口 { 其中position_list参数代表的是用户的行驶点, area参数代表的是服务区的坐标点, ...

  4. vue3 +vite+ts实战项目添加 eslint + prettier + lint-staged 踩坑指南

    初始化项目 // 创建一个空的 vue3-ts 项目, yarn create vite my-vue-app --template vue-ts // 安装依赖 cd my-vue-app & ...

  5. 搭建react项目,react+ts,react+typescript

    1.使用create-react-app my-react 目前使用create-react-app会遇到以下错误提示: 该错提示我们 您正在运行 create-react-app 5.0.0,它落后 ...

  6. react项目启动报错”无法使用 JSX,除非提供了 “--jsx“ 标志。ts(17004)“

    react项目启动报错"无法使用 JSX,除非提供了 "–jsx" 标志.ts(17004)" 原因 由于react版本与ts版本不匹配导致 解决 tsconf ...

  7. 项目使用ts辅助_我如何建立辅助项目并在第一周获得31,000名用户

    项目使用ts辅助 by Jurn W 由Jurn W 我如何建立辅助项目并在第一周获得31,000名用户 (How I Built my Side Project and Got 31,000 Use ...

  8. 搭建react项目教程(二)

    搭建react项目教程(二) 一:概述 二:配置 1:配置依赖包 2:添加与后台交互的配置文件 3:封装API调用方法 4:与后台交互 5:启动项目验证接口 一:概述 1:书接上文搭建react项目教 ...

  9. 前端项目搭建部署全流程(一):搭建React项目

    1.前言 前段时间突发一个想法,想尝试从零开始搭建一个React项目模板,发布到GitHub,再编写脚手架命令拉取模板以及编写脚本命令快速生成业务模块,然后再用这个模板结合之前的一套组件库,完成编译打 ...

最新文章

  1. linux floating ip,Floating IP in OpenStack Neutron
  2. website for .Net Core
  3. SpringBoot - 探究Spring Boot应用是如何通过java -jar 启动的
  4. ios 顶部tab滑动实现_iOS开发之多表视图滑动切换示例(仿头条客户端)
  5. Java怎么不启动_dubbo不启动了怎么回事???一模一样的另一个没问题
  6. Python使用tkinter的Treeview组件实现表格功能
  7. php常见web安全问题,web安全面试常见问题(来自微博)
  8. EclipseIDEA使用经验
  9. cher怎么翻译中文_中文翻译法语收费标准是怎么定的
  10. python概率密度函数参数估计_概率密度估计介绍
  11. 用自己电脑做网站服务器
  12. 如何用计算机名安装打印机,如何添加打印机,教您添加共享打印机的方法
  13. python文章抄袭检测_CSDN文章被洗稿、抄袭严重!用Python做一个“基于搜索引擎的文章查重工具”,解决!...
  14. 【毕业设计】43-基于单片机的红外无线防盗报警系统设计与实现(原理图工程源文件+源代码+实物图+答辩论文)
  15. Python练习题答案: 杰克的家【难度:2级】--景越Python编程实例训练营,1000道上机题等你来挑战
  16. 模板引擎Beet的6大创新点
  17. Lytro Power Tool使用记录
  18. 第8天 鼠标控制与32位模式切换
  19. 设计模式在美团外卖营销业务中的实践
  20. 【物联网】14.物联网设备控制器选择 - 单片机(MCU)

热门文章

  1. TIM_OCMode_PWM2;TIM_OCMode_PWM1
  2. 字符串反转句子StringReverseSentence
  3. 江苏盐城发生5.0级地震——海中地震如何定位地震发生位置
  4. shared_ptr初始化方式
  5. 简单几步骤查看天猫国际同行大量商品的发布、下架时间
  6. 秒杀excel数据透视表,又一逆天可视化分析神器
  7. htonl/htons以及ntohl/ntohs等函数使用说明
  8. 查SCN 及它scn所对的时间点
  9. Python BFS和DFS算法
  10. clickonce 部署能cs程序_配置 ClickOnce 信任提示行为 - Visual Studio | Microsoft Docs